- In this informative training video, Bill Marais, DTG, will demonstrate all of his techniques utilizing full contour zirconia. Bill will show how he can manipulate the GC Initial Zirconia Disks in the green state to achieve ideal contour and overall desired shapes. Additionally, Bill will demonstrate his application of the GC Initial IQ Lustre Pastes and his layering techniques with the GC Initial ZR-FS for a superior final restorative option.
